had the same problem with mine, turned it upside down, took the screws out, removed 2 bolts that hold hone assembly to motor, had to use a razor knife between magnet and blade, once I got it loose was able to super glue it back in place, mine's an old one, had it since 2004, can't find good info for replacement parts

I just had the same problem with my 300. I did the same thing as the 2nd commenter did (including the super glue) but one of my coarse hones is missing. This seems to be a common problem with this model.
I sometimes see these sharpeners at thrift stores. I guess next time I'll buy one for backup parts as the Chef's Choice site doesn't offer them as replacement parts.

I had the same exact situation as you. They told me that they discontinued replacing of the stones when Covid started. And suggested I buy a new one and these are not inexpensive. They offered me like a 25% off or something I just was so disappointed.
They also suggested going on eBay to see if I could get any of the parts and try to do it myself. Chef's choice does not replace the stones themselves. It was another company and I don't remember the name but researching I did find them but they would not service
directly and they wouldn't help.
